Continuing his penchant for fitness, he has attempted to run from Ahmedabad to Mumbai, barefoot. That's a distance of 527 kms, and to do that barefoot, you'll have to doff your hat to this athlete.
During the Ironman triathlon championships last year. Soman completed a course of a 3.8-km swim, an 180.2-km cycle ride and a 42.2-km run in just over 15 hours.
Out of the 527 kms, Soman's covered almost 130
kms in just two days. He doesn't have any comforts of a car ride, bike
or even a cycle to cover the length of his journey - just his bare feet
and his strong will to excel.
He doesn't even look like he's breaking a sweat even though he's sweating profusely in the video. And despite the bad weather and humidity, he hasn't given up!
